SUMMARY:Guest Speaker - Dr Maria Cunningham (UNSW)
DESCRIPTION:<h2>Understanding Star Formation in the Age of &ldquo;Big Data&rdquo; and &
 ldquo;Software Telescopes&rdquo;</h2><p>Star formation in the Milky Way and
  other Galaxies is governed by the interplay between gravity, turbulence, a
 nd magnetic fields. However, we still do not have a good understanding of h
 ow stars form, and how they influence, and are influenced by, their local e
 nvironment.&nbsp;</p><p>In this talk I will describe why understanding star
  formation is important for understanding the evolution of the Universe &nd
 ash; massive stars drive the evolution of galaxies, which are the building 
 blocks of the Universe &ndash; and how both large numbers of astrophysical 
 observations combined with computer modelling can help us understand star f
 ormation.</p><p>This talk will emphasise the role of observations of molecu
 les in space for understanding star formation, including understanding how 
 complex molecules may be delivered to the surface of newly formed planets b
 y comets and meteorites, seeding life.</p><h2><img src="images/articles/Mar
 ia_Cunningham.jpg" alt="Maria Cunningham" style="margin-right: 20px; float:
  left;" />Dr Maria Cunningham</h2><p>is Senior Lecturer in Astrophysics at 
 the Universtity of New South Walres</p><p>Her research interests are in rad
 io, millimetre and sub-millimetre astronomy, molecular line astronomy, bioa
 stronomy and computational astrophysics.</p><p>Dr Cunningham is currently w
 orking on several projects, including:</p><ul><li>Detecting new complex org
 anic molecules in space, and hopefully finding some of the building blocks 
 of life;</li><li>Using very complex organic molecules to put an evolutionar
 y sequence on the formation of stars;</li><li>Determining how the structure
  of the Milky Galaxy affect the formation of stars,...</li></ul><p>In 2015 
 UNSW&rsquo;s Postgraduate Council awarded Dr Maria Cunningham the "Outstand
 ing Excellence in Postgraduate Research Supervision Award".</p>
